New River, a semi-rural community in northern Maricopa County north of Phoenix, has 3 funeral providers listed in the directory. Best Funeral Services West Valley Chapel, Eternal Cremations, and Sunrise Funeral Home & Crematory all serve families in this area. The inclusion of both a dedicated cremation service and a full crematory-equipped funeral home gives families two distinct approaches to cremation. New River's rural character means many families also look to nearby Peoria or Phoenix providers for full-service options. Under the FTC Funeral Rule, every provider must furnish an itemized General Price List on request before any services are arranged.

Funeral costs in New River vary widely depending on services selected. A traditional funeral with viewing can range from $7,000-$12,000 or more, while direct cremation in New River typically costs $1,000-$3,000. Request the General Price List (GPL) from each New River funeral home to compare specific costs for burial, cremation, and memorial services.
Burial services in New River involve preparing the body, holding a viewing or service, and interment in a cemetery. Cremation in New River reduces the body to ashes through high-temperature processing, which can then be kept in an urn, scattered, or buried. Many New River funeral homes offer both options along with memorial services.

Yes, most funeral homes in New River offer pre-planning services. Pre-planning allows you to make decisions about your funeral or a loved one's service in advance, often at current prices. New River funeral directors can help document your wishes and establish pre-payment arrangements if desired, providing peace of mind for your family.
When meeting with funeral homes in New River, bring identification, the deceased's vital information (birth certificate, social security number), information about military service if applicable, and any pre-planning documents. New River funeral directors will guide you through required paperwork and help you understand what additional documentation is needed.

| Service Type | Estimated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Direct Cremation | $1,500 – $3,500 |
| Cremation with Memorial Service | $3,500 – $6,500 |
| Traditional Burial | $7,000 – $12,000 |
| Full Funeral with Viewing | $8,000 – $15,000+ |
| Graveside Service Only | $2,500 – $5,000 |
Prices are estimates based on national averages and publicly available General Price Lists. Always request the current GPL from each funeral home before making arrangements.
